What is the Reg 490 B
The Reg 490 B is a specific form used for the inspection of salvage vehicles by the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V). This form is essential for individuals who wish to register a vehicle that has been declared a total loss or salvage. It serves as a declaration of the vehicle's condition and ensures that it meets safety and regulatory standards before it can be legally driven on public roads.

Steps to complete the Reg 490 B
Completing the Reg 490 B involves several key steps:
- Gather necessary documentation, including proof of ownership and any previous title information.
- Fill out the form with accurate details regarding the vehicle's make, model, year, and VIN (Vehicle Identification Number).
- Provide information about the vehicle's salvage status and any repairs made.
- Submit the completed form along with any required fees to the DMV.

Required Documents
When submitting the Reg 490 B, individuals typically need to provide several documents, including:
- A valid identification, such as a driver's license.
- Proof of ownership, such as a bill of sale or previous title.
- Documentation of repairs made to the vehicle, if applicable.
- Any additional forms required by the state DMV.
State-specific rules for the Reg 490 B
Each state may have its own specific rules regarding the Reg 490 B. It is important to review local regulations to understand any additional requirements or variations in the inspection process. Some states may require additional inspections or certifications, while others may have different fees associated with the salvage vehicle registration process.

What is a DMV salvage vehicle inspection?
A DMV salvage vehicle inspection is a process required by the Department of Motor Vehicles to verify the condition and safety of a vehicle that has been declared salvage. This inspection ensures that the vehicle meets safety standards before it can be registered for road use. Completing a DMV salvage vehicle inspection is crucial for obtaining a rebuilt title.
-
How much does a DMV salvage vehicle inspection cost?
The cost of a DMV salvage vehicle inspection can vary by state and inspection facility. Typically, fees range from $50 to $150, depending on the complexity of the inspection and any additional services required. It's advisable to check with your local DMV or inspection station for specific pricing details.
-
What documents do I need for a DMV salvage vehicle inspection?
To complete a DMV salvage vehicle inspection, you will generally need the vehicle's title, proof of ownership, and any previous inspection reports. Additionally, having a valid ID and any repair receipts can help streamline the process. Always check with your local DMV for specific documentation requirements.
-
How long does a DMV salvage vehicle inspection take?
The duration of a DMV salvage vehicle inspection can vary, but it typically takes between 30 minutes to an hour. Factors such as the inspection facility's workload and the vehicle's condition can affect the time required. It's best to schedule an appointment to minimize wait times.
-
What happens if my vehicle fails the DMV salvage vehicle inspection?
If your vehicle fails the DMV salvage vehicle inspection, you will receive a report detailing the reasons for the failure. You will need to address the identified issues and schedule a re-inspection. It's important to resolve any safety concerns to ensure your vehicle can be legally registered.
